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Курсовые проекты » Об'єктно-орієнтоване програмування мовою С ++

Реферат Об'єктно-орієнтоване програмування мовою С ++





mp; (Edit2- gt; Text == ) amp; amp; (Edit3- gt; Text == )

amp;amp;(Edit4-gt;Text==laquo;raquo;)amp;amp;(Edit20-gt;Text==laquo;raquo;)amp;amp;(Edit21-gt;Text==laquo;raquo;))

{throw (1);} ((Edit1- gt; Text == ) || (Edit2- gt; Text == ) || (Edit3- gt ; Text == )

||(Edit4-gt;Text==laquo;raquo;)||(Edit20-gt;Text==laquo;raquo;)||(Edit21-gt;Text==laquo;raquo;))

{throw ( a );}=(Edit1- gt; Text);=StrToInt (Edit2- gt; Text);=StrToInt (Edit3- gt; Text);=StrToInt(Edit4-gt;Text);=StrToInt(Edit20-gt;Text);=StrToInt(Edit21-gt;Text);m(name,power,cena,obv1,pow11,kolnas);=amp;m;gt;print(StringGrid4,j3);

//m.print (StringGrid4, j3);

} (char b)

{MessageDlg ( Заповніть поля! ra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);

} (int a)

{MessageDlg ( Заповнені не всі поля! Будуть виведені значення за замовчуванням! ra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);

pilesos m; .print (StringGrid4, j3);

} (EConvertError amp; err)

{MessageDlg ( Перевірте введення даних ra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);}

}

}

//-----------------

//копіювання для БК__fastcall TForm1 :: Button2Click (TObject * Sender)

{

{q1; name, raspoloshenie; power, cena, max_temp, kol_kamer;=Edit12- gt; Text; (q1 == ) {throw (1);} - gt; Visible =True; - gt; Visible=True; pos=StrToInt (Edit12- gt; Text);=StringGrid1- gt; Cells [0] [pos];=StrToInt (StringGrid1- gt; Cells [1] [pos]); =StrToInt (StringGrid1- gt; Cells [2] [pos]); _ temp=StrToInt (StringGrid1- gt; Cells [3] [pos]); _ kamer=StrToInt (StringGrid1- gt; Cells [4] [pos]); =StringGrid1- gt; Cells [5] [pos]; _ kamera n (name, power, cena, max_temp, kol_kamer, raspoloshenie);

moroz_kamera m (n);// в об'єкт m копіюємо n

m.print (StringGrid8, x1);

} (int a)

{MessageDlg ( Введіть № запису для копіювання ra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);

} (EConvertError amp; err)

{MessageDlg ( Перевірте введення даних ra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);}

}

//Порівняння для канц товаров__fastcall TForm1 :: Button3Click (TObject * Sender)

{try

{int a1, a2; o1, o2;=Edit10- gt; Text;=Edit11- gt; Text; (o1 == ) {throw (1);} (o2 == ) {throw(2);}=StrToInt(Edit10-gt;Text);=StrToInt(Edit11-gt;Text);m1(StringGrid2-gt;Cells[0][a1],StrToInt(StringGrid2-gt;Cells[1][a1]),StrToInt(StringGrid2-gt;Cells[2][a1]),StrToInt(StringGrid2-gt;Cells[3][a1]),StrToInt(StringGrid2-gt;Cells[4][a1]),StringGrid2-gt;Cells[5][a1]);pic m2(StringGrid2-gt;Cells[0][a2],StrToInt(StringGrid2-gt;Cells[1][a2]),StrToInt(StringGrid2-gt;Cells[2][a2]),StrToInt(StringGrid2-gt;Cells[3][a2]),StrToInt(StringGrid2-gt;Cells[4][a2]),StringGrid2-gt;Cells[5][a2]);if (m1 == m2) {Edit13- gt; Text= Дорівнюють raquo ;;} else {Edit13- gt; Text= не дорівнює raquo ;;}//порівняння

} (int a)

{MessageDlg ( Заповніть поля! ra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);} (EConvertError amp; err)

{MessageDlg ( Перевірте введення даних ra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);}

}

//Сравненіе__fastcall TForm1 :: Button3Click (TObject * Sender)

{try {a1, a2; o1, o2;=Edit10- gt; Text;=Edit11- gt; Text; (o1 == ) {throw (1);} ( o2 == ) {throw(2);}=StrToInt(Edit10-gt;Text);=StrToInt(Edit11-gt;Text);ob1(StringGrid2-gt;Cells[0][a1],StrToInt(StringGrid2-gt;Cells[1][a1]),StrToInt(StringGrid2-gt;Cells[2][a1]),StrToInt(StringGrid2-gt;Cells[3][a1]),StrToInt(StringGrid2-gt;Cells[4][a1]),StringGrid2-gt;Cells[5][a1]);holodilniki ob2(StringGrid2-gt;Cells[0][a2],StrToInt(StringGrid2-gt;Cells[1][a2]),StrToInt(StringGrid2-gt;Cells[2][a2]),StrToInt(StringGrid2-gt;Cells[3][a2]),StrToInt(StringGrid2-gt;Cells[4][a2]),StringGrid2-gt;Cells[5][a2]);if (ob1 == ob2) {Edit13- gt; Text= Дорівнюють raquo ;;} else {Edit13- gt; Text= не дорівнює raquo ;;}//порівняння (перевантаження)

} catch (int a)

{MessageDlg ( Заповніть поля! ra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);} (EConvertError amp; err)

{MessageDlg ( Перевірте введення даних raquo ;, mtError, TMsgDlgButtons () lt; lt; mbOK, 0);}

}//------------------ Edit14...


Назад | сторінка 10 з 14 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Phonetic peculiarities of the popular science text
  • Реферат на тему: Grammar of the Text: its Basic Units and Main Features (based on the novel ...
  • Реферат на тему: Технології аналізу даних (Text Mining, Data Mining)
  • Реферат на тему: Оператори введення - виведення даних
  • Реферат на тему: Введення і редагування даних в Excel